Subject: [PATCH v5 11/18] btrfs: Replace fs_info->cache_workers workqueue with btrfs_workqueue.
Date: Fri, 28 Feb 2014 10:46:12 +0800	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<1393555579-11271-12-git-send-email-quwenruo@cn.fujitsu.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<1393555579-11271-1-git-send-email-quwenruo@cn.fujitsu.com>

Replace the fs_info->cache_workers with the newly created
btrfs_workqueue.

Signed-off-by: Qu Wenruo <quwenruo@cn.fujitsu.com>
Tested-by: David Sterba <dsterba@suse.cz>
---
Changelog:
v1->v2:
  None
v2->v3:
  - Use the btrfs_workqueue_struct to replace submit_workers.
v3->v4:
  - Use the simplified btrfs_alloc_workqueue API.
v4->v5:
  None
---
 fs/btrfs/ctree.h       |  4 ++--
 fs/btrfs/disk-io.c     | 10 +++++-----
 fs/btrfs/extent-tree.c |  6 +++---
 fs/btrfs/super.c       |  2 +-
 4 files changed, 11 insertions(+), 11 deletions(-)

diff --git a/fs/btrfs/ctree.h b/fs/btrfs/ctree.h
index a7b0bdd..06a64fb 100644
--- a/fs/btrfs/ctree.h
+++ b/fs/btrfs/ctree.h
@@ -1221,7 +1221,7 @@ struct btrfs_caching_control {
 	struct list_head list;
 	struct mutex mutex;
 	wait_queue_head_t wait;
-	struct btrfs_work work;
+	struct btrfs_work_struct work;
 	struct btrfs_block_group_cache *block_group;
 	u64 progress;
 	atomic_t count;
@@ -1516,7 +1516,7 @@ struct btrfs_fs_info {
 	struct btrfs_workqueue_struct *endio_write_workers;
 	struct btrfs_workqueue_struct *endio_freespace_worker;
 	struct btrfs_workqueue_struct *submit_workers;
-	struct btrfs_workers caching_workers;
+	struct btrfs_workqueue_struct *caching_workers;
 	struct btrfs_workers readahead_workers;
 
 	/*
diff --git a/fs/btrfs/disk-io.c b/fs/btrfs/disk-io.c
index 12586b1..391cadf 100644
--- a/fs/btrfs/disk-io.c
+++ b/fs/btrfs/disk-io.c
@@ -2003,7 +2003,7 @@ static void btrfs_stop_all_workers(struct btrfs_fs_info *fs_info)
 	btrfs_destroy_workqueue(fs_info->endio_freespace_worker);
 	btrfs_destroy_workqueue(fs_info->submit_workers);
 	btrfs_stop_workers(&fs_info->delayed_workers);
-	btrfs_stop_workers(&fs_info->caching_workers);
+	btrfs_destroy_workqueue(fs_info->caching_workers);
 	btrfs_stop_workers(&fs_info->readahead_workers);
 	btrfs_destroy_workqueue(fs_info->flush_workers);
 	btrfs_stop_workers(&fs_info->qgroup_rescan_workers);
@@ -2481,8 +2481,8 @@ int open_ctree(struct super_block *sb,
 	fs_info->flush_workers =
 		btrfs_alloc_workqueue("flush_delalloc", flags, max_active, 0);
 
-	btrfs_init_workers(&fs_info->caching_workers, "cache",
-			   fs_info->thread_pool_size, NULL);
+	fs_info->caching_workers =
+		btrfs_alloc_workqueue("cache", flags, max_active, 0);
 
 	/*
 	 * a higher idle thresh on the submit workers makes it much more
@@ -2533,7 +2533,6 @@ int open_ctree(struct super_block *sb,
 	ret = btrfs_start_workers(&fs_info->generic_worker);
 	ret |= btrfs_start_workers(&fs_info->fixup_workers);
 	ret |= btrfs_start_workers(&fs_info->delayed_workers);
-	ret |= btrfs_start_workers(&fs_info->caching_workers);
 	ret |= btrfs_start_workers(&fs_info->readahead_workers);
 	ret |= btrfs_start_workers(&fs_info->qgroup_rescan_workers);
 	if (ret) {
@@ -2545,7 +2544,8 @@ int open_ctree(struct super_block *sb,
 	      fs_info->endio_workers && fs_info->endio_meta_workers &&
 	      fs_info->endio_meta_write_workers &&
 	      fs_info->endio_write_workers && fs_info->endio_raid56_workers &&
-	      fs_info->endio_freespace_worker && fs_info->rmw_workers)) {
+	      fs_info->endio_freespace_worker && fs_info->rmw_workers &&
+	      fs_info->caching_workers)) {
 		err = -ENOMEM;
 		goto fail_sb_buffer;
 	}
diff --git a/fs/btrfs/extent-tree.c b/fs/btrfs/extent-tree.c
index 32312e0..bb58082 100644
--- a/fs/btrfs/extent-tree.c
+++ b/fs/btrfs/extent-tree.c
@@ -378,7 +378,7 @@ static u64 add_new_free_space(struct btrfs_block_group_cache *block_group,
 	return total_added;
 }
 
-static noinline void caching_thread(struct btrfs_work *work)
+static noinline void caching_thread(struct btrfs_work_struct *work)
 {
 	struct btrfs_block_group_cache *block_group;
 	struct btrfs_fs_info *fs_info;
@@ -549,7 +549,7 @@ static int cache_block_group(struct btrfs_block_group_cache *cache,
 	caching_ctl->block_group = cache;
 	caching_ctl->progress = cache->key.objectid;
 	atomic_set(&caching_ctl->count, 1);
-	caching_ctl->work.func = caching_thread;
+	btrfs_init_work(&caching_ctl->work, caching_thread, NULL, NULL);
 
 	spin_lock(&cache->lock);
 	/*
@@ -640,7 +640,7 @@ static int cache_block_group(struct btrfs_block_group_cache *cache,
 
 	btrfs_get_block_group(cache);
 
-	btrfs_queue_worker(&fs_info->caching_workers, &caching_ctl->work);
+	btrfs_queue_work(fs_info->caching_workers, &caching_ctl->work);
 
 	return ret;
 }
diff --git a/fs/btrfs/super.c b/fs/btrfs/super.c
index 919eb36..cd52e20 100644
--- a/fs/btrfs/super.c
+++ b/fs/btrfs/super.c
@@ -1320,7 +1320,7 @@ static void btrfs_resize_thread_pool(struct btrfs_fs_info *fs_info,
 	btrfs_workqueue_set_max(fs_info->workers, new_pool_size);
 	btrfs_workqueue_set_max(fs_info->delalloc_workers, new_pool_size);
 	btrfs_workqueue_set_max(fs_info->submit_workers, new_pool_size);
-	btrfs_set_max_workers(&fs_info->caching_workers, new_pool_size);
+	btrfs_workqueue_set_max(fs_info->caching_workers, new_pool_size);
 	btrfs_set_max_workers(&fs_info->fixup_workers, new_pool_size);
 	btrfs_workqueue_set_max(fs_info->endio_workers, new_pool_size);
 	btrfs_workqueue_set_max(fs_info->endio_meta_workers, new_pool_size);
